Method
Prepare the Batter
- In a medium mixing bowl, mash the ripe banana with a fork until mostly smooth. A few small lumps are perfectly fine.
- Add the milk, egg, maple syrup, and vanilla extract to the mashed banana. Whisk well until combined.
- Stir in the rolled oats, baking powder, ground cinnamon, and salt. Mix thoroughly until all ingredients are well incorporated and the oats are fully coated. If using, fold in half of your optional chocolate chips or chopped nuts now.
Air Fry and Serve
- Lightly grease your small oven-safe ramekin or baking dish. Pour the oat mixture into the prepared dish. Top with the remaining chocolate chips or nuts, if desired, and a couple of banana slices for a nice presentation.
- Preheat your air fryer to 350°F (175°C) for 3-5 minutes.
- Carefully place the ramekin into the air fryer basket. Cook for 20-25 minutes, or until the top is golden brown, set, and a toothpick inserted into the center comes out mostly clean.
- Once cooked, carefully remove the ramekin from the air fryer. Let it cool for 5 minutes before serving directly from the ramekin. Enjoy your warm and delicious banana bread baked oats!
Notes
This recipe is best enjoyed fresh from the air fryer. For meal prep, you can mix the dry ingredients ahead of time. You can also bake this in a conventional oven at 375°F (190°C) for 20-25 minutes. Feel free to adjust the sweetness to your liking. Add a scoop of protein powder for an extra boost of protein, reducing the milk by a tablespoon or two if the batter becomes too thick.
